本文介绍了如何掌握Min函数的使用方法,从入门到精通,通过学习本文,读者可以了解Min函数的基本概念和用途,掌握其基本的语法和用法,并深入了解其在数据处理和计算中的应用,本文旨在帮助读者从初学者到熟练掌握Min函数的使用技巧,提高工作效率和数据处理的准确性。

深入了解Min函数:从入门到精通

在数据处理和分析的过程中,我们经常需要找到一组数据中的最小值,这时,Min函数就显得尤为重要,无论是在Excel表格中还是编程过程中,Min函数都是一个非常实用的工具,本文将详细介绍Min函数的使用方法,帮助读者从入门到精通掌握这一技能。

什么是Min函数?

Min函数是一种用于返回一组数值中的最小值的函数,在不同的应用场景中,Min函数的具体形式和用法可能有所不同,但其核心功能都是相同的——帮助我们快速找到一组数据中的最小值。

在Excel中使用Min函数

掌握Min函数的使用方法,从入门到精通  第1张

图片来自网络

在Excel中,Min函数是一个非常实用的工具,用于找到一系列数值中的最小值,以下是使用Min函数的步骤:

  1. 打开Excel表格,选中需要输入最小值的单元格。
  2. 在选中的单元格中输入“=MIN(数值范围)”,这里的数值范围可以是具体的单元格范围,也可以是具体的数值。=MIN(A1:A10)”表示求A1到A10单元格范围内的最小值。
  3. 按下回车键,即可得到最小值。

Excel的Min函数还支持嵌套使用,即在一个Min函数内部再调用另一个Min函数,以找到多列数据中的最小值。=MIN(MIN(A1:A5),MIN(B1:B5))”,表示求A列和B列中每行的最小值中的最小值。

在编程中使用Min函数

在编程中,Min函数的使用方式与Excel中有所不同,不同的编程语言可能有不同的Min函数实现方式,以下是在一些常见编程语言中使用Min函数的示例:

  1. Python中的Min函数:Python的内置函数min()可以用于求取一组数值中的最小值,例如min([1, 2, 3, 4])将返回1,min()函数还可以用于比较字符串、列表等其他类型的数据。
  2. JavaScript中的Min函数:在JavaScript中,可以使用Math.min()函数来求取一组数值中的最小值,例如Math.min(1, 2, 3, 4)将返回1,Math.min()还可以接受更多参数,并返回所有参数中的最小值。
  3. C++中的Min函数:在C++中,可以使用STL库中的min函数来求取两个数值中的最小值,例如min(a, b)将返回a和b中的较小值,C++的min函数还可以用于比较其他类型的数据,如字符串等。

高级应用技巧

除了基本的用法外,Min函数还有一些高级应用技巧值得我们掌握:

  1. 结合条件使用Min函数:在某些情况下,我们可能需要根据特定条件来求取最小值,这时可以结合使用If函数或其他条件语句来实现,在Excel中,可以使用“=MIN(IF(条件,数值范围))”的形式来求取满足特定条件的数值中的最小值。
  2. 使用数组公式实现动态引用:在某些情况下,我们可能需要动态地引用数据范围来求取最小值,在Excel中,可以选中一个数据范围并输入“=MIN(数据范围)”后按下Ctrl+Shift+Enter键来创建一个数组公式,这样,当数据范围发生变化时,最小值也会自动更新。
  3. 结合其他函数使用:除了单独使用Min函数外,我们还可以将其与其他函数结合使用以实现更复杂的操作,例如结合使用Sum、Average等函数来求取满足特定条件的数值的平均值或总和等。

注意事项

在使用Min函数时,需要注意以下几点:

  1. 确保数据的有效性:在使用Min函数之前,确保数据的有效性是非常重要的,因为无效的数据可能会导致错误的结果。
  2. 注意数据类型:不同的数据类型可能会影响Min函数的结果,因此在使用Min函数时需要注意数据类型的问题,在Excel中,如果单元格中包含文本和数值混合的数据,可能会导致Min函数无法正确计算最小值,因此最好将数据转换为统一的格式再进行计算,在某些编程语言中,不同类型的参数可能需要使用不同的Min函数实现,因此需要仔细查看文档以了解正确的使用方法,总之在使用Min函数时需要注意数据类型的问题以确保结果的准确性。

通过掌握这些注意事项,我们可以更加有效地使用Min函数并避免不必要的错误和麻烦,同时我们还可以不断学习和探索更多关于数据处理和分析的技巧和方法以提高工作效率和质量,不断实践和学习逐渐掌握更多的数据处理和分析技能从而更好地应对各种挑战和任务需求实现个人和职业的发展目标,总之学习和掌握数据处理和分析技能是一项非常有价值的投资它可以帮助我们更好地应对未来的挑战和机遇实现个人和职业的发展目标,让我们一起努力掌握数据处理和分析技能为未来的成功打下坚实的基础吧!此外还需要注意以下几点:对于大量数据的处理要关注效率问题选择合适的工具或编程语言以优化数据处理过程;对于复杂的数据分析任务需要掌握更多的统计方法和分析技巧以得出准确可靠的结论;不断关注最新的数据处理和分析技术以跟上行业发展的步伐保持竞争力。